What the register says changed

These are the mapping notes training.gov.au attaches to each supersession, quoted as the register writes them. They are the only public record of what actually changed between two versions.

  • AHC52116AHC52122not equivalent23 January 2023

    Updated core unit with unit from SIT training package. Updated codes and titles of all units. Core unit elevated to AQF6

What AHC52122 is made of

training.gov.au lists 29 units for AHC52122: 4 core and 25 elective. To complete it, the register publishes a rule of 4 core units plus 8 electives12 units in all.

Core units 4 listed

CodeUnitIn this product
AHCPER418Provide advice on permaculture principles and practicescurrent
AHCPER514Design an integrated permaculture systemcurrent
AHCPER601Develop a strategic plan for a permaculture project or enterprisecurrent
SITXMGT006Manage projectscurrent
